Skills & Requirements 

  • A full and relevant level 3 qualification is required 
  • A good understanding of the EYFS to enable you to observe, plan and keep accurate records of the children’s learning 
  • Experience working in a nursery setting 
  • A passion to provide high quality childcare 
  • The ability to work as part of a team 
  • Good communication and grasp of the English language 

Responsibilities & Duties 

  • Leading your team to ensure the highest standards of care and education are maintained 
  • Reporting to senior management and working with them to develop and improve provision 
  • Looking after babies from 3 months up to pre-school who are almost 5, depending on the room you are based in ensuring the nursery runs smoothly whilst working as part of a team and using your ideas to provide a fun environment for the children in your care 
  • Completing written observations and progress reviews to share with the children’s families and any agencies we are working with 
  • Planning and implementing activities to progress children’s learning 
  • Following and implementing all inclusion, safeguarding and health and safety policies and procedures 
  • Using your excellent communication skills to welcome everyone that comes into our nursery and build strong relationships with our parents, children and team
